Axios delete documentation. delete('api/users', {params: {'id': this.
- Axios delete documentation. There are no other projects in the npm registry using axios. Making a DELETE Request with Axios and React. 12. Get, Post, and Delete API requests are among the most common daily requests made by developers. Provide details and share your research! But avoid …. What is Axios? Axios is a promise-based HTTP Client for node. Axios POST request: create new Tutorial. It allows you to send a DELETE request to a specified URL to remove a resource. Axios API The Axios Instance Request Config Response Schema Config Defaults Interceptors Handling Errors Cancellation 🆕 URL-Encoding Bodies 🆕 Multipart Bodies Other Notes May 3, 2022 · Related Posts: POST form data (also including a file) using Axios; A Free REST API Service; Download Progress Bar with Axios; Build a REST API with Node. js using Axios to handle the APIs. defaults. json in your code editor. jsを使う際に、標準のfetch API以外、requestモジュール、axiosのモジュールはよく使います。 書き方はGithubのページに書いてありますが、よくGoogle先生に聞く場合も多いです。 Axios API. js http module – On the client-side (browser) it uses XMLHttpRequests Oct 8, 2018 · You are not specifying what your Post component should delete. js and the browser. Nov 1, 2024 · To make a DELETE request using Axios, you need to use the axios. Related Posts: Vue Fetch example - Get/Post/Put/Delete with Rest API Sep 14, 2019 · #はじめに Node. DELETE requests are HTTP requests that delete a specific resource identified by a URL. checkedNames}) Mar 22, 2022 · Axios Features. post To send data with Axios, we use the post convenience method with the URL of the API we send the request to as the first argument, and the data we want to send as the second argument. 4, last published: 9 hours ago. axios(config) import axios from 'axios Promise based HTTP client for the browser and node. Requests will default to GET if method is not specified. delete() is the Axios options, not the request body. Whether you're a seasoned programmer or just getting started, this post will guide you through creating robust APIs efficiently. To send an HTTP delete request using axios, we will use the delete() method present in the axios module. default; Mar 29, 2021 · I'm trying to build a CRUD app connecting the front and back via API. 7, last published: 21 days ago. Vue Axios POST request: create new Tutorial; Vue Axios PUT request: update an existing Tutorial; Vue Axios DELETE request: delete a Tutorial, delete all Tutorials; For instruction, please visit: Vue Axios example - Get/Post/Put/Delete with Rest API. delete('api/users', {params: {'id': this. And modify the "scripts" to execute parcel for dev and build: Nov 17, 2020 · How do i remove them for a specific axios get request? I saw some answers were they used before the request. common["X-Requested-With"]; delete axios. May 15, 2020 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. for that you would pass it like this : Jan 19, 2021 · I need to delete the element but don't know how to get that specific element! This is the structure of data on Firebase And this is the code: import React, {useState, useEffect} from 'react'; import May 19, 2023 · You can make DELETE requests using Axios like you make POST and PUT requests. Axios PUT request: update an existing Tutorial. {// `url` is the server URL that will be used for the request url: '/user', // `method` is the request method to be used when making the request method: 'get', // default // `baseURL` will be prepended to `url` unless `url` is absolute. Jul 22, 2019 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question. delete is not receiving an id to pass up to your parent component. const res = await axios. This article will focus on how to use Axios for DELETE requests and explore different ways of passing parameters. js and Browser with the same codebase. There are 137744 other projects in the npm registry using axios. 5--save-dev ; At this point, you will have a new project with axios and parcel-bundler. Jan 22, 2022 · I try to delete backup with DELETE method in Laravel and Axios but the request is comming back empty. Jul 7, 2021 · Remember that the 2nd parameter to axios. request. Here's a simplified example: Mar 2, 2017 · I'm afraid you're using axios. Just like its name suggests, a DELETE request will delete a resource from the server side. delete() method returns a promise May 31, 2019 · “I've seen on various posts, that a data object can actually be sent with a delete request. Nov 29, 2023 · You should also note that axios can also be used on the server with node. We'll modify the GetData component to include a deletePost function: Promise based HTTP client for the browser and node. props. Promise based HTTP client for the browser and node. A referência de API do Axios. Axios Delete Request Code Example To perform a DELETE request in Axios you can call the "delete" method of the "axios" object. React Action Creator When you add request interceptors, they are presumed to be asynchronous by default. You can't pass the request body as the 2nd parameter like you can with axios. delete(props. You can import the module in your code like this: const axios = require ('axios') However, many IDE and code editors can offer better autocompletion when importing like this: const axios = require ('axios'). post() or axios. axios-retry: Axios plugin that intercepts failed requests and retries them whenever possible. 4, last published: 3 days ago. This method accepts the resource URL and if there's any configuration then it can be passed as the 2nd parameter. Other HTTP examples available: May 27, 2020 · I am trying to make an Axios DELETE request to my Express server. 可以向 axios 传递相关配置来创建请求. The response data is logged to the console if the request is successful, and any errors are caught and logged. id) and then in your parent component you need to have the handleDelete method receive the id of the item you want to target which is the id we passed up earlier from Post. The default delete route when using Resource expects a single parameter. delete(URL, Sep 16, 2020 · I am performing a delete request with axios but I do not understand why these 2 syntax work differently. . Requisições podem ser feitas passando as configuraçãos relevantes para o axios. Finally, let's add a button to delete a post using Axios. put or axios. The URL is the same as the one you would use for the http module, and the config object can contain additional parameters and headers for the request. Request Config. 也可以额外传递第二个参数 params 发送携带参数的 DELETE 请求。 Mar 18, 2021 · npm install parcel-bundler @1. Sep 11, 2020 · Axios has a axios. Aug 3, 2021 · We will build a HTTP Client to make CRUD requests to Rest API in that: Axios GET request: get all Tutorials, get Tutorial by Id, find Tutorial by title. Documentation didn't really explain the delete part very well. js, Express, and Axios. delete() function that makes it easy to send an HTTP DELETE request to a given URL. This method takes two arguments: a URL and an optional config object. By using axios. Axios API Axios API The Axios Instance Request Config Response Schema Config Defaults Interceptors Handling Errors Cancellation 🆕 URL-Encoding Bodies 🆕 Multipart Bodies Other Notes Contributors Sponsoring Axios Code of Conduct Collaborator Guide Contributing to Axios Translating these docs Axios API Axios Instance Cấu hình Request Kết cấu Response Cấu hình Mặc định Bộ đón chặn Xử trí lỗi Bãi bỏ request Phần thân URL-Encoding Cái khác Ghi chú 携带参数的 DELETE 请求 . It sucessfully console. Getting Started.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and In this tutorial, you will learn how to use an HTTP delete method in javaScript using axios library. There are 173228 other projects in the npm registry using axios. You can replace the onSubmitFormHandler of the code for making a POST request with the event handler below to make a DELETE request. Axios is a popular HTTP request library that can send asynchronous requests in both browser and Node. To do so I need the headers: headers: { 'Authorization': } and the body is composed of var p Aug 12, 2024 · The axios. I've got the app working with vanilla JS but I wanted to build it with Vue. Controller /** * Remove the specified resource from storage. 7, last published: 7 days ago. Next, open package. So when doing: axios. Did you find this tutorial useful? Axios API. It is one of the most commonly used HTTP methods, along with GET, POST, and PUT/PATCH. May 17, 2022 · In this guide, we will learn how to make Axios GET, POST, and DELETE API requests in React. // Send a GET request (default method) axios ('/user/12345'); Request method aliases For convenience aliases have been provided for all supported request methods. The delete method accepts two arguments; a URL as the first argument and an optional config object as the second argument. How can I remove the data with the deleteContact() method? My greatest struggle is how to get the deleteContact() method right. There are 137998 other projects in the npm registry using axios. delete method. com Apr 14, 2023 · Axios DELETE requests. delete just like a axios. These are the available config options for making requests. Asking for help, clarification, or responding to other answers. This method takes the URL as its first argument and optional configuration options as the second argument. Apr 23, 2021 · Below is a quick set of examples to show how to send HTTP DELETE requests from React to a backend API using the axios HTTP client which is available on npm. headers. id"> <t Axios API Axios API Axios Instance Cấu hình Request Kết cấu Response Cấu hình Mặc định Bộ đón chặn Xử trí lỗi Bãi bỏ request Phần thân URL-Encoding Cái khác Ghi chú Đóng góp Quy tắc ứng xử Hướng dẫn người đóng góp Đóng góp cho Axios Phiên dịch tài liệu này Jun 4, 2023 · This function uses Axios to make a POST request to the JSONPlaceholder API with the form data as the request body. The axios. The app works with Dec 31, 2018 · I am fetching data from the jsonplaceholder API into my state. delete method is used to send the DELETE request. delete() method. Jun 27, 2019 · Why my delete function is not working in VueJS? I have a table that displays the data from NodeJS and renders to VueJS <tr v-for="result in filteredPeople" :key="result. Jun 28, 2018 · I'm using Axios while programming in ReactJS and I pretend to send a DELETE request to my server. My backend is node. delete, you'll send an id to a server, and the server itself will find a resource that matches that given id, only then it will be removed (or trigger some action, but the request is mapped as a http delete). common["X-CSRF-TOKEN"]; But these will delete them entirely, any ideas? Thanks and regards! Nov 17, 2017 · as I can see in your code above, you pass Positionseloquent as a parameter to destroy method but in your vueJS you don't pass this object. 7. js. Axios API参考. In other words, the props. When using axios. The await keyword ensures that the function waits for the request to complete before continuing. Axios can run in the Node. The argument is the URL endpoint of the resource to be deleted. Jul 16, 2018 · You could pass the movie object to the removeMovie function in your List component and pass that to the this. moxios: Mock Axios requests for testing I'm trying to make a delete request in React with Axios. The rest of the code remains the same: Promise based HTTP client for the browser and node. After a big struggle i found this working solution by testing through postman deleteChart(id Axios API Axios API The Axios Instance Request Config Response Schema Config Defaults Interceptors Handling Errors Cancellation 🆕 URL-Encoding Bodies 🆕 Multipart Bodies Other Notes Contributors Sponsoring Axios Code of Conduct Collaborator Guide Contributing to Axios Translating these docs Sep 24, 2017 · It is because of the method signatures. Only the url is required. use (function {/* Nov 29, 2020 · The easiest way to create a DELETE request with Axios is by using axios. js – probably one of my favorite higher level HTTP libraries. If you are using CommonJS, there are two methods in Node. Start using axios in your project by running `npm i axios`. The first parameter is the URL (type string) and the second is the body of the request (type object or type string). interceptors. log(res) and hits the controller givi Sep 19, 2021 · Importing Axios. If you need to remove an interceptor later you can. Axios DELETE request: delete a Tutorial, delete all Tutorials. Oct 12, 2021 · データを削除する場合は、axios. This simply refers to how we retrieve data from an API, add data to the API, and then delete data from our API. post or (axios. removeClick function. delete axios. 2, last published: 2 months ago. One of the better qualities when using it on the server is the ability to create an instance with defaults – for example sometimes I’ll need to access another REST API to integrate another service with one of our products, if there is no existing package How to send data with axios. This method accepts two parameters. delete('https: See full list on jasonwatmore. The DELETE request method is idempotent, meaning that if a request is sent multiple times, the outcome should be the same as sending it once. This can cause a delay in the execution of your axios request when the main thread is blocked (a promise is created under the hood for the interceptor and your request gets put on the bottom of the call stack). You could then take the id of the movie to use for your request, and remove the movie from state if the DELETE request is successful. Mar 3, 2021 · In this article, you will learn how to make a delete request using Axios. Latest version: 1. 7, last published: 3 days ago. In order to do that, you can change that to => props. Feb 6, 2023 · Popular Axios libraries to extend its functionality axios-mock-adapter: Axios adapter that allows easy mock requests; axios-hooks: React hooks for Axios, with built-in support for server-side rendering. axios(config) // 发起一个post请求 axios ({method: 'post', url: '/user/12345 Dec 29, 2022 · Promise based HTTP client for the browser and node. There are 138915 other projects in the npm registry using axios. – On the server-side it uses the native Node. put() . 5, last published: 4 days ago. delete()メソッドを使います。ただし、データIDで識別するため、IDを指定しないといけません。 ただし、データIDで識別するため、IDを指定しないといけません。 Oct 9, 2023 · Editor’s note: This article was last updated on 9 October 2023 to update code snippets based on the newest Axios version and include information about global headers, conditional headers, and solutions for common HTTP headers-related issues. It is isomorphic (= it can run in the browser and nodejs with the same codebase). Mar 28, 2024 · In Axios, you can easily make a DELETE request with the axios. I've looked through every discussion and each solution does not work. There are 174844 other projects in the npm registry using axios. ” - referring specifically to Axios, or just whether a DELETE request can have a body or not in general? What you quoted from the docs might simply indicate that Axios does not send a body when method: "delete" is specified, not matter whether you Promise based HTTP client for the browser and node. js to import the library. js and Express Sep 2, 2023 · At the core of making a DELETE request with Axios is the axios. I'm having trouble passing the data properly through axios. Let's assume we have an array of objects containing a list of users, a list we probably have gotten from an endpoint. patch). const myInterceptor = axios. Is t Nov 1, 2024 · Hey there, fellow developers! Today, we're diving deep into the world of building APIs using Node. js environments. pdstkb nhqru dvtmw xkkmyez nhpl kdbixr jppsi rlime hfsgb ldtm